And in case you came from a not perfectly up-to-date system and (dist-)upgraded 
to 18.04, you might have missed a fix that is needed for the upgrade (LP 
1766727).
Be sure to be up-to-date on the OS you going to upgrade from - means do an "apt 
full-upgrade" prior to the "do-release-upgrade" to be on the save side.
